The Olympus OM-D E-M10 Mark IV is a compact and versatile mirrorless camera perfect for both beginners and experienced photographers seeking high-quality images and 4K video. Its lightweight design, combined with advanced features like in-body image stabilization and a flip-down touchscreen, makes it ideal for everyday use and travel photography. However, it's worth noting that the included kit lens may not suit all specialized photography needs.
